Ex-Iowa State star Uwazurike accused of betting on Cyclones games in which he played

Former Iowa State defensive lineman Enyi Uwazurike is alleged to have bet on college and NFL games in which he played, according to documents the Story County attorney provided the Des Moines Register late Tuesday afternoon. The FanDuel account controlled by Uwazurike completed approximately 801 mobile on-line sports wagers, totaling “over $21,361,” the complaint states. Four of the wagers were on Iowa State football games in which he played – Sept.

11, 2021 against Iowa, and Oct. 2, 2021, against Kansas. Both games were played at Jack Trice Stadium in Ames.

The document also alleges that a FanDuel account controlled by Uwazurike placed “approximately 32” wagers on Broncos games and individual Broncos players. The report alleges five Broncos games on which Uwazurike bet, including two in which he played, according to on-line game reports – Dec. 11, 2022, against Kansas City and Dec.

18, 2022, against Arizona. Uwazurike, picked by Denver in the fourth round of the 2022 NFL Draft, was suspended indefinitely by the NFL last month for allegedly placing bets on NFL games. Before being drafted, Uwazurike spent six seasons at Iowa State.

He made 46 starts and played in 60 games in his career, the second-most games played in school history. He finished his standout career with 144 tackles, 34. 5 tackles for loss, 15.

0 sacks, two fumble recoveries, 15 quarterback hurries and two blocked field goals. He was first-Team All-Big 12 in 2021. .
